Question:

An investigation of the relationship between x = traffic flow (thousands of cars per 24 hours) and y 5 lead content of bark on trees near the highway (mg/g dry weight) yielded the accompanying data. A simple linear regression model was fit, and the resulting estimated regression line was y^ = 28.7 1 33.3x. Both residuals and standardized residuals are also given.
An investigation of the relationship between x = traffic flow

a. Plot the (x, residual) pairs. Does the resulting plot suggest that a simple linear regression model is an appropriate choice? Explain your reasoning.
b. Construct a standardized residual plot. Does the plot differ significantly in general appearance from the plot in Part (a)?
